#320efc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#320efc is composed of 19.6% red, 5.5%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 249.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 52.2%. #320efc color hex could be obtained by blending #641cff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#320efc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#320efc has RGB values of R:50, G:14,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 3280636.

Hex triplet 320efc #320efc
RGB Decimal 50, 14, 252 rgb(50,14,252)
RGB Percent 19.6, 5.5, 98.8 rgb(19.6%,5.5%,98.8%)
CMYK 80, 94, 0, 1
HSL 249.1°, 97.5, 52.2 hsl(249.1,97.5%,52.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 249.1°, 94.4, 98.8
Web Safe 3300ff #3300ff
CIE-LAB 34.023, 76.941, -103.265
XYZ 19.04, 8.019, 92.635
xyY 0.159, 0.067, 8.019
CIE-LCH 34.023, 128.777, 306.689
CIE-LUV 34.023, -6.77, -130.635
Hunter-Lab 28.318, 70.457, -174.127
Binary 00110010, 00001110, 11111100

Shades and Tints of #320efc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000b is the darkest color, while #f8f6ff is the lightest one.
